Output 85fffb74d11ab5621de8539f0377179193353bceffbbfcfc0f603bb730897462:5

value
20102855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01d1f4175d6e27fe240ce2462b9b9b4f955db2db OP_EQUAL
address
31re7ZPUb3apzD6d9tgqD3rD83WUoVvaPX
transaction
85fffb74d11ab5621de8539f0377179193353bceffbbfcfc0f603bb730897462
confirmations
473918
spent
true